Transaction ed39658a24adc72e089ed24bcd5ecb8f6d826a4fb2b2a043cee42ec5a91831f3

50 Input
2 Outputs
  • ed39658a24adc72e089ed24bcd5ecb8f6d826a4fb2b2a043cee42ec5a91831f3:0
  • value  444012141
    address  3FfkTqJ54ncC77dwAgFqjXNt4weAeVTANV
  • ed39658a24adc72e089ed24bcd5ecb8f6d826a4fb2b2a043cee42ec5a91831f3:1
  • value  1036859
    address  3D98T2petsshiNcRb1SUA2ruFCtbX8xHyR